> Hi Phil,
>
> That reminds me that tomorrow, December 26, was the date of issue on
> my novice ticket back in 1956.  Tomorrow I will have been licensed
> for 53 years.  Of course, I bootlegged a couple of months before my
> ticket arrived.  We were in Alaska at the time and it took the FCC
> six months to get my ticket to me.  I was just 16 years old and
> couldn't wait any longer.  I bootlegged a friend's call who was off
> on a weather flight and wouldn't you know it, a friend of his gave me
> a call.  The next radio club meeting he mentioned to my friend that
> he had enjoyed their QSO, whereupon my friend mentioned he was off on
> a flight.  They turned and looked at me.  I was pretty embarrassed
> and was ham celebate for the next couple of months till my ticket arrived.
